Commit 05f254a6369ac020fc0382a7cbd3ef64ad997c92 ("ALSA: usb-audio: Improve filtering of sample rates on Focusrite devices") changed the check for max_rate in a way which was overly restrictive, forcing devices to use very high samplerates if they support them, despite support existing for lower rates as well.
This maintains the intended outcome (ensuring samplerates selected are supported) while allowing devices with higher maximum samplerates to be opened at all supported samplerates.
This patch was tested with a Clarett+ 8Pre USB
